Схема данных – это логическое представление структуры и организации информации, хранящейся в базе данных или других информационных системах. Она определяет типы данных, их атрибуты и связи между ними. В схеме данных указываются все объекты, которые содержат информацию, такие как таблицы, поля, ключи, индексы и другие элементы базы данных.
Роль схемы данных в организации хранения информации невозможно переоценить. Она является основой для построения и манипулирования данными в информационной системе. Схема данных определяет, как данные будут храниться, какие операции доступа к ним будут возможны и как будет производиться их обработка.
Схема данных позволяет структурировать информацию и обеспечивает целостность базы данных. Она определяет, какие связи существуют между различными типами данных и как данные могут быть извлечены или изменены.
Также схема данных играет важную роль в разработке программного обеспечения. Она служит основой для создания моделей данных и определения требований к системе. Кроме того, схема данных упрощает поддержку и администрирование базы данных, позволяя легко вносить изменения в структуру данных и обеспечивая совместимость между различными версиями системы.
Определение схемы данных
Схема данных представляет собой структуру, которая определяет организацию и хранение информации в базе данных. Схема данных описывает таблицы, атрибуты, типы данных и связи между таблицами.
Схема данных является ключевым элементом при проектировании базы данных. Она помогает определить, какие данные будут храниться в базе данных, как они будут организованы и как они будут связаны между собой.
Схема данных включает в себя следующие элементы:
- Таблицы: определяют основные сущности, которые будут храниться в базе данных. Каждая таблица имеет столбцы (атрибуты) и строки (записи).
- Атрибуты: определяют характеристики данных в таблице. Каждый атрибут имеет имя и тип данных.
- Связи: определяют отношения между таблицами. Они помогают связать данные из разных таблиц и обеспечивают целостность данных.
- Ограничения: определяют правила, которые должны соблюдаться при вставке, обновлении или удалении данных. Они гарантируют корректность данных и защиту базы данных от ошибок.
- Индексы: оптимизируют поиск данных в базе данных. Они создаются для определенных столбцов и ускоряют выполнение запросов.
Создание и использование схемы данных является важным шагом при разработке базы данных. Она помогает структурировать информацию, обеспечивает эффективное хранение и доступ к данным, а также обеспечивает целостность и безопасность базы данных.
Понятие и особенности схемы данных
Схема данных является важным инструментом для организации хранения информации, так как она позволяет определить, какие данные будут храниться и как они будут связаны между собой. Схема данных обеспечивает целостность и консистентность информации, а также облегчает выполнение запросов к базе данных и обеспечивает эффективность работы системы.
Одной из особенностей схемы данных является ее гибкость. Она может быть изменена в процессе развития системы и адаптирована под новые требования и потребности. При этом изменение схемы данных может потребовать значительных усилий, так как это может повлечь изменение структуры существующих данных и их преобразование в новые форматы.
Схема данных также обеспечивает безопасность данных, определяя доступ и ограничения на изменение и удаление информации. Она позволяет установить права доступа к данным для различных пользователей и групп пользователей, а также контролировать целостность и конфиденциальность данных.
Таким образом, схема данных играет важную роль в организации хранения информации, определяя структуру и связи между данными, обеспечивая безопасность и гибкость системы.
Значение схемы данных в организации
Основная роль схемы данных заключается в предоставлении логической модели базы данных, которая описывает все сущности, атрибуты и связи между ними. Схема данных определяет типы данных, ограничения целостности и правила, которым должны следовать данные при вставке, обновлении или удалении.
Значение схемы данных в организации состоит в следующем:
- Определение структуры данных: схема данных формализует способ хранения и организацию информации, что позволяет эффективно использовать пространство и ресурсы сервера базы данных.
- Обеспечение целостности данных: схема данных содержит ограничения целостности, которые гарантируют правильность и надежность данных в базе. Например, она может определить, что поле «имя» не может быть пустым или что значение определенного атрибута должно быть уникальным.
- Удобство использования: правильно спроектированная схема данных позволяет упростить процессы добавления, изменения и удаления данных. Она облегчает написание запросов к базе данных и помогает автоматизировать определенные операции.
- Масштабируемость и гибкость: схема данных должна быть способна приспосабливаться к изменениям в потребностях и требованиях организации, а также поддерживать масштабирование базы данных при необходимости.
Таким образом, схема данных играет важную роль в организации хранения информации, обеспечивая целостность, эффективность и удобство использования баз данных.
Роль схемы данных
Схема данных играет ключевую роль в организации хранения информации. Она представляет собой структуру или модель, которая определяет способ организации и хранения данных в компьютерной системе.
Роль схемы данных включает:
- Определение структуры данных: схема данных описывает типы данных, атрибуты и связи между ними. Она помогает установить правила, по которым данные хранятся и организуются в базе данных.
- Обеспечение целостности данных: схема данных определяет ограничения и правила, которые гарантируют целостность и соответствие данных определенным требованиям.
- Управление доступом к данным: схема данных может определять права и разрешения доступа для различных пользователей или групп пользователей. Это обеспечивает защиту данных и контроль над тем, кто может получить доступ к определенным данным.
- Повышение эффективности хранения: схема данных может оптимизировать хранение данных, позволяя экономить пространство и ресурсы. Она может определять способы сжатия данных, индексацию и другие методы оптимизации.
- Поддержка анализа данных: схема данных может облегчать анализ и извлечение данных. Она может предоставить структуру, которая упрощает поиск, фильтрацию и агрегацию данных для получения нужной информации.
Таким образом, схема данных играет важную роль в организации хранения информации. Она обеспечивает структуру, целостность, безопасность и эффективность хранения данных, что является основой для эффективного управления информацией в организации.
Описание роли схемы данных в организации
Схема данных включает в себя описание всех таблиц, полей, связей между таблицами и ограничений, которые определяют правила работы с данными. Она является основой для создания и использования базы данных и предоставляет программным и аппаратным средствам системы доступ к нужным данным.
Роль схемы данных в организации заключается в следующем:
- Определение структуры данных. Схема данных определяет, какие данные будут храниться, в каких таблицах они будут размещены и какие связи между ними существуют. Она обеспечивает четкое понимание структуры информационной системы и помогает предотвратить ошибки при работе с данными.
- Обеспечение целостности данных. Схема данных определяет правила и ограничения, которые обеспечивают целостность данных. Она определяет, какие значения допустимы для каждого поля, какие связи между данными существуют и какие операции можно выполнять с данными. Это позволяет предотвратить ошибки и нежелательные изменения данных.
- Управление доступом к данным. Схема данных определяет права доступа к данным для пользователей и ролей. Она контролирует, кто может читать, изменять и удалять данные, и определяет ограничения для выполнения определенных операций. Это обеспечивает безопасность данных и предотвращает несанкционированный доступ к информации.
- Оптимизация запросов к данным. Схема данных определяет, как данные будут организованы и храниться, чтобы обеспечить быстрый доступ к ним. Она позволяет оптимизировать запросы к данным, исключая необходимость сканировать всю базу данных. Это улучшает производительность системы и сокращает время выполнения операций.
- Удобство анализа данных. Схема данных облегчает анализ данных и создание отчетов. Она определяет, как данные связаны и как они могут быть объединены для получения нужной информации. Она также позволяет задать различные условия и фильтры для анализа данных. Это упрощает работу с большим объемом информации и позволяет быстро получать нужные результаты.
В целом, схема данных играет ключевую роль в организации хранения и использования информации. Она обеспечивает структурированное представление данных, контроль доступа к ним, оптимизацию производительности и упрощение работы с информацией.
Примеры применения схемы данных
1. Базы данных
Схема данных играет важную роль при проектировании баз данных. Она определяет структуру и организацию данных, которые хранятся в базе. Например, схема данных может определить таблицы, их поля и связи между ними. Благодаря этому, база данных может эффективно хранить и обрабатывать информацию.
2. Реляционная модель
Схема данных также применяется в реляционной модели данных. Она определяет структуру и ограничения данных, которые хранятся в реляционной базе данных. Например, схема данных может определить таблицы, их атрибуты и связи между ними. Это позволяет эффективно организовывать и анализировать информацию в реляционной базе данных.
3. XML и JSON
Схемы данных могут быть использованы для определения структуры и формата данных в XML и JSON. Например, XML-схема может определить элементы, их атрибуты и иерархию в документе. А JSON-схема может определить свойства и типы данных объектов в JSON-документе. Это позволяет установить четкие правила для формата и структуры данных в этих форматах.
4. API и веб-сервисы
Схемы данных широко используются для описания и документирования API и веб-сервисов. Например, схема WSDL (Web Services Description Language) может определить структуру и формат сообщений, которые передаются по веб-сервису. Это позволяет разработчикам легко понять и использовать API и веб-сервисы.
5. Визуализация и документация
Схемы данных могут использоваться для визуализации и документации структуры данных в организации. Например, схема ER (Entity-Relationship) может показать сущности, их атрибуты и связи между ними. Это поможет лучше понять и документировать структуру данных в организации.
В целом, схема данных широко применяется в различных областях, связанных с организацией хранения информации. Она позволяет определить структуру и организацию данных, что облегчает их хранение и обработку.
Организация хранения информации
Одним из ключевых элементов организации хранения информации является схема данных. Схема данных представляет собой графическое или текстовое представление структуры данных, используемой в информационной системе. Она описывает различные таблицы, поля, связи между ними и ограничения на данные.
Схема данных играет важную роль в организации хранения информации. Она позволяет определить, каким образом данные будут храниться и организованы в системе. Схема данных определяет типы данных, длину полей, ключи, индексы и другие параметры, которые могут быть применены к данным.
Благодаря схеме данных можно эффективно управлять и анализировать информацию. Она обеспечивает стандартизацию данных в системе и позволяет лучше понять их структуру и связи между ними. Схема данных также обеспечивает целостность данных и защиту от ошибок, так как в ней определены ограничения на данные и правила их валидации.
Важно разработать схему данных с учетом текущих и будущих требований к информационной системе. Она должна быть гибкой и масштабируемой, чтобы легко адаптироваться к изменениям и добавлению новой функциональности. Разработка схемы данных требует тщательного анализа бизнес-процессов компании и понимания потребностей пользователей.
В итоге, правильная организация хранения информации, основанная на схеме данных, позволяет эффективно управлять данными, обеспечивает их целостность и защиту, улучшает производительность системы и снижает риски возникновения ошибок.
Методы и подходы к организации хранения информации
- Реляционная модель: это один из наиболее распространенных методов организации хранения информации. Данные в реляционной модели представлены в виде таблиц, где каждая таблица представляет собой отдельную сущность, а строки и столбцы таблицы соответствуют атрибутам этой сущности. Такая организация данных обеспечивает структурированный подход к их хранению и позволяет выполнять сложные запросы.
- Иерархическая модель: данный подход организации хранения информации представляет данные в виде древовидной структуры. Каждый узел дерева соответствует отдельной сущности, а связи между узлами являются отношениями. Такая модель обеспечивает эффективный доступ к информации, но может ограничивать гибкость в обработке данных.
- Объектно-ориентированная модель: в этом подходе данные структурируются в виде объектов с определенными свойствами и методами. Такая модель позволяет гибко организовывать данные и устанавливать связи между объектами. Она особенно хорошо подходит для проектирования сложных систем и обработки больших объемов данных.
- NoSQL: это семейство методов организации хранения информации, которые отличаются от реляционной модели. В основе таких методов лежит принцип гибкости и масштабируемости. Некоторые из самых популярных подходов включают облачные базы данных, документоориентированные базы данных и графовые базы данных.
Каждый метод и подход к организации хранения информации имеет свои преимущества и недостатки, и выбор конкретного метода зависит от требований и особенностей конкретной системы.